What is a remote manager accounts receivable?

A Remote Manager Accounts Receivable is a professional who oversees an organization's accounts receivable operations while working remotely. Their primary responsibilities include managing the invoicing process, ensuring timely collection of payments, monitoring outstanding accounts, and maintaining accurate financial records. They also lead and support a team of accounts receivable staff, implement best practices, and communicate with clients to resolve payment issues. This role requires strong organizational, communication, and analytical skills, as well as proficiency with accounting software. Working remotely, they utilize digital tools to coordinate tasks and maintain effective workflows.

How does a remote manager accounts receivable effectively oversee team performance and ensure timely collections while working offsite?

A Remote Manager Accounts Receivable relies on digital tools such as accounting software, shared dashboards, and regular video meetings to track team progress and collection metrics. Clear communication and well-defined processes are essential for setting expectations and addressing challenges related to overdue accounts. Managers often schedule recurring check-ins to review aging reports, provide feedback, and support team development. Remote collaboration with sales, customer service, and finance teams is also crucial for resolving disputes and streamlining collections. Proactive use of these strategies helps maintain high performance and cash flow, even in a distributed work environment.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a remote manager accounts receivable, and why are they important?

To excel as a Remote Manager Accounts Receivable, you need a strong background in accounting principles, financial analysis, and experience managing receivables, typically backed by a relevant degree or certification such as a CPA. Proficiency with accounting software like QuickBooks, SAP, or Oracle, as well as familiarity with ERP systems and spreadsheets, is essential. Outstanding organizational skills, attention to detail, and the ability to communicate clearly and lead remote teams are vital soft skills. These competencies ensure efficient cash flow management, accuracy in financial reporting, and effective coordination across distributed teams.

The Manager, Accounts Receivable (AR) is responsible for providing leadership and oversight of accounts receivable operations within the Centralized Business Office (CBO) for behavioral health services. This role ensures timely, accurate thirdparty billing, payment posting, and followup activities across the operating system, clearinghouse, and denial management platforms. The Manager oversees AR workflows to drive optimal reimbursement performance, including claim resolution, denial prevention and appeals, and accurate adjustment processing. This position plays a key role in managing daily AR operations, monitoring performance metrics, and ensuring compliance with payer requirements, while supporting a highperforming CBO servicing multiple behavioral health facilities.

How you'll contribute 

A Manager, Accounts Receivable who excels in this role:

  • Ensure staff accurately perform billing, collections, and accounts receivable followup for multiple facilities across all payer types.

  • Partner closely on accounts receivable strategy, performance, and revenue cycle initiatives.

  • Maintain financial integrity of daily operations through continuous monitoring of AR performance, productivity metrics, and workflow efficiency.

  • Provide professional, operational, and technical guidance to AR staff; address escalated issues related to payer responses, account balances, and patient or family inquiries.

  • Serve as administrator for payer portals and website access as needed to support staff efficiency and security.

  • Ensure accurate capture, posting, reconciliation, and maintenance of all financial transactions, adjustments, and balances in alignment with payer mix and acuity across facilities.

  • Communicate effectively with Utilization Review departments to ensure timely and accurate exchange of information impacting billing, authorizations, and denials.

  • Assign and manage staff work queues through billing software; monitor progress and ensure timely completion of assigned tasks.

  • Maintain ongoing communication with facility Business Office Managers to address facilityspecific AR issues and operational needs.

  • Develop, implement, monitor, and evaluate AR quality assurance processes to ensure compliance with applicable laws, regulations, payer requirements, and internal policies.

  • Recommend, develop, and update accounts receivable policies and procedures to support operational consistency and best practices.

  • Review and approve all adjustments and refunds to ensure accuracy, compliance, and appropriate documentation.

  • Attend, prepare for, and actively participate in weekly accounts receivable review calls.

  • Support monthend A/R close activities, including reconciliation, reporting, and variance resolution.

  • Participate in the hiring, training, supervision, and performance evaluation of assigned accounts receivable staff.

  • Conduct routine audits of collection documentation and notes to assess effectiveness, identify training needs, and address performance or corrective actions as appropriate.
